Guidry, Brandi N.; Stevens, David P.; Totaro, Michael W. – Journal of Information Systems Education, 2011
This study examines instructors' perceptions regarding the skills and topics that are most important in the teaching of a Systems Analysis and Design ("SAD") course and the class time devoted to each. A large number of Information Systems ("IS") educators at AACSB accredited schools across the United States were surveyed.…
